Mich wunderte die höhere Zahl bei allstringspeak. Meine Anlage hat 17,225kWp und der allstringspeak zeigt 19,225 an. Einen niedrigeren Wert könnte ich nachvollziehen, der höhere kommt mir komisch vor.

DS_Starter

Die Norm-Peakleistung von Solarmodulen wird bei 25°C angegeben. Höhere Temperaturen führen zu sinkenden Peaks, niedrigere zu höheren Peaks.
Ist wie gesagt eine begrenzende Größe und hat für den User keine direkte Bedeutung.

Für das SolCast Model habe ich noch ein Attr eingebaut um dem User die Möglichkeit zu geben außer dem mittleren Percentil alternativ auch das 10er oder 90er Percentil auszuwählen.
In der letzten Zeit hatte ich festgestellt, dass immer deutlich mehr erzeugt wurde als prognostiziert (außer heute da Schnee auf den Zellen lag).
Wenn man sich die kommende Verteilung auf der SolCast Seite anschaut, sieht man wie stark abweichend das 90er Percentil von dem 50er default ist. Möglicherweise macht es Sinn sich für ein abweichendes Percentil entscheiden zu können.


affectSolCastPercentile <10 | 50 | 90>

(nur bei Verwendung Model SolCastAPI)

Auswahl des Wahrscheinlichkeitsbereiches der gelieferten SolCast-Daten. SolCast liefert die 10- und 90-prozentige Wahrscheinlichkeit um den Prognosemittelwert (50) herum.
(default: 50)
